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
766938 446 1419520846 2136212320
82571560996 9197392
82571560996 9197392
3024 6052 6307550696 156325144 87
All about undefined
Interested in learning more?
82571560996 9197392
3024 6052 6307550696 156325144 87
See more
5786084 55 207634
354 641 264118 0519718185
See more
99247174 07822528 41
33868 0593 23680841968
See more